Text

Any special act to the contrary notwithstanding, the legislative body of any town having a city or town manager as its chief executive officer, may, by ordinance, permit the chief executive officer to appoint (1) not more than six departmental coordinators to coordinate work of department heads and (2) a deputy city or town manager and assistants to such deputy. A departmental coordinator may be designated as a deputy city or town manager or as an assistant to such deputy. Any coordinator, deputy city or town manager or assistant to such deputy shall serve at the pleasure of the chief executive officer.

Legislative History

(P.A. 74-234; P.A. 91-370.) History: P.A. 91-370 deleted provision limiting applicability to towns of 50,000 or more population, designated existing appointment authority as Subdiv. (1) and added new Subdiv. (2) concerning appointment by city or town manager of a deputy city or town manager and assistants and added language re designation of departmental director as deputy and re terms.
